formation of company - An Overview
You will get your mail wherever you will be – irrespective of whether that’s at your house in the UK or abroad on small business – and your company deal with will continue being exactly the same regardless.Beginning a company? You may sign up a Confined Company without spending a dime and open up a company account with ANNA simultaneously. It